Baixe o app para aproveitar ainda mais
Prévia do material em texto
17/04/2017 Aluno: JEREMIAS POCINIO DA SILVA • http://estacio.webaula.com.br/salaframe.asp?curso=10066&turma=752343&AcessoSomenteLeitura=N&shwmdl=1 1/3 De acordo como processo de desenvolvimento baseado em componentes, analise as assertivas e assinale a alternativa que aponta a(s) correta(s). I Desenvolvimento de arquiteturas complexas a partir de unidades bem especificadas e testada. II Tem como foco na decomposição da estrutura da funcionalidade individual ou componente lógico dele expondo bem definido a interface de comunicação contendo seus métodos, eventos e propriedades. III Componentes podem ser objetos, conjunto de objetos, sistemas ou qualquer implementação que seja dependente e autosuficiente. Somente III é verdadeira Somente I é verdadeira. Somente II é verdadeira. I e II são verdadeiras I e III são verdadeiras 2a Questão (Ref.: 201503073169) Fórum de Dúvidas (0) Saiba (0) De acordo como processo de desenvolvimento baseado em componentes, analise as assertivas e assinale a alternativa que aponta a(s) correta(s). I Desenvolvimento de arquiteturas complexas a partir de unidades bem especificadas e testada. II Tem como foco na decomposição da estrutura da funcionalidade individual ou componente lógico dele expondo bem definido a interface de comunicação contendo seus métodos, eventos e propriedades. III Componentes podem ser objetos, conjunto de objetos, sistemas ou qualquer implementação que seja dependente e autosuficiente. Somente II é verdadeira. Somente III é verdadeira Somente I é verdadeira. I e II são verdadeiras I e II são verdadeiras 3a Questão (Ref.: 201503073170) Fórum de Dúvidas (0) Saiba (0) No contexto de arquitetura de sistemas, os componentes são unidades de software estruturados de acordo com alguns princípios. Sendo assim, identifique a qual princípio pertence a descrição abaixo: O usuário de um componente de software é isolado de como os dados desse componente de software é armazenado ou como suas funções são executadas. O cliente depende da especificação do componente, mas não da sua implementação. Extensibilidade 17/04/2017 Aluno: JEREMIAS POCINIO DA SILVA • http://estacio.webaula.com.br/salaframe.asp?curso=10066&turma=752343&AcessoSomenteLeitura=N&shwmdl=1 2/3 Reusabilidade Produtividade Encapsulamento Independência 4a Questão (Ref.: 201503163036) Fórum de Dúvidas (0) Saiba (0) Em relação aos níveis de modelo, descubra qual modelo que é independente do tipo de software ou de tecnologia, e representa o problema a ser resolvido. Modelo de Projeto Modelo de Especificação Modelo Conceitual Modelo de Requisitos Modelo de Implementação 5a Questão (Ref.: 201503163037) Fórum de Dúvidas (0) Saiba (0) Em relação aos níveis de modelo, descubra qual modelo que representa os componentes de softwares utilizados. Modelo Conceitual Modelo de Especificação Modelo de Implementação Modelo de Implantação Modelo de Projeto 6a Questão (Ref.: 201503163032) Fórum de Dúvidas (0) Saiba (0) Em relação ao conceito de componentes é correto afirmar que: Componentes, no contexto da arquitetura de sistemas, são unidades de software não estruturados de acordo com alguns princípios específicos. Não existe a necessidade de existir nos componentes uma relação natural com o que ele representa. Cada componente encapsulado pode ter mais de uma identidade de dados e funções e podendo assumir estados prédeterminados. Um mesmo componente pode ter mais de uma interface. Um componente é um objeto, derivado de uma classe, mas sem assinatura explícita. 7a Questão (Ref.: 201503163033) Fórum de Dúvidas (0) Saiba (0) No contexto dos componentes, considere as seguintes afirmativas: I. Componentes são usualmente estruturados para ser reutilizado em diferentes cenários e diferentes aplicações. II. Componentes são estruturados para ter o máximo de dependência com outros componentes. Por isso componentes pode ser disponibilizados dentro de um ambiente apropriado sem afetar outros componentes ou sistemas. 17/04/2017 Aluno: JEREMIAS POCINIO DA SILVA • http://estacio.webaula.com.br/salaframe.asp?curso=10066&turma=752343&AcessoSomenteLeitura=N&shwmdl=1 3/3 III. Componentes expõe uma interface dele para os invocadores utilizar suas funcionalidades e não revelar detalhes do seu processo interno ou alguma variável interna e estado. Levandose em conta as afirmações acima, identifique a única alternativa válida. Apenas a II e a II estão corretas. I, II e II estão corretas. Apenas a I e a III estão corretas. I, II e III estão incorretas. Apenas a I e a II estão corretas. 8a Questão (Ref.: 201503163034) Fórum de Dúvidas (0) Saiba (0) Arquitetura baseada em componentes descreve uma abordagem da engenharia de software para estrutura e desenvolvimento de sistemas. Associe a sentença abaixo ao respectivo conceito. "Componentes expõe uma interface dele para os invocadores utilizar suas funcionalidades e não revelar detalhes do seu processo interno ou alguma variável interna e estado." Encapsulamento Substituição Extensibilidade Independência Reusabilidade
Compartilhar